Luther: BBC Season Four Special Airs December 17th

luther

The detective is back. After a two year absence, a one-night Luther special will air on BBC America on December 17th.

Last year, it was announced that FOX would be adapting the BBC series for American television, but plans have been delayed due to casting issues.

Written by show creator Neil Cross, this Luther special will feature Idris Elba as the dedicated Detective John Luther who is pitted against a “cannibalistic serial killer.”

Here’s BBC’s official description:

Golden Globe® winner Idris Elba (Beasts of No Nation, Star Trek Beyond) returns to his iconic role as a self-destructive near-genius detective on the edge of law enforcement.  Detective Chief Inspector John Luther (Elba) will learn the hard way; he may never be able to walk away from capturing the tormented psychopaths that lurk the streets of London. His attempt to leave the darker side of humanity behind for a chance at a “normal” life is quickly thwarted when he’s drawn into a terrifyingly complex case. A cannibalistic serial killer delivers a devastating blow that not only pulls him out of seclusion but pushes him closer to the edge than he’s ever been. A BBC AMERICA co-production, the gripping, psychological thriller Luther makes its highly-anticipated return in a one-night special event on Thursday, December 17, 9:00pm ET.”
